Do scented candles give you headaches? Does the smell of air fresheners, cleaning supplies, or insecticides make you feel nauseous, dizzy, or lightheaded? You may be experiencing Multiple Chemical Sensitivity (MCS)—a condition that's becoming increasingly common as our exposure to everyday toxins continues to grow. In this episode of Better Than Before Breast Cancer, we dive into what MCS is, why it matters for your long-term health (especially after cancer), and how to reduce your body's toxic burden without giving up the comforts you love. You'll learn practical tips for detoxifying your home, safe alternatives to synthetic fragrances, and simple ways to create a healing environment that supports your immune system, nervous system, and overall well-being.
